 GMC Sierra Price 

Price is often the first factor buyers consider, and the GMC Sierra price reflects its premium engineering while remaining competitive. The starting price varies depending on trims and features:

  • GMC Sierra 1500: Base trim starts around $43,000.

  • GMC Sierra SLE and Elevation: Mid-tier trims with extra features, priced between $45,000-$55,000.

  • GMC Sierra Denali: Premium trim with luxury finishes, starting at $63,000+.

  • Special Editions & AT4 Off-Road Models: Prices go higher based on performance upgrades.

Considering its technology, interior quality, and towing capability, the Sierra offers excellent value for both work and lifestyle purposes.

 GMC Sierra Specs

When it comes to trucks, performance is non-negotiable. The GMC Sierra specs ensure you get both power and efficiency:

  • Engine Options:

    • 4.3L V6 with 285 HP

    • 5.3L V8 with 355 HP

    • 6.2L V8 with 420 HP (available in Denali trim)

    • 3.0L Turbo-Diesel I6 (for fuel efficiency and torque)

  • Transmission: 10-speed automatic for smooth shifting.

  • Drivetrain: Rear-wheel drive (RWD) or four-wheel drive (4WD).

  • Payload Capacity: Up to 2,280 lbs depending on configuration.

  • Towing Capacity: Impressive GMC Sierra towing capacity of up to 13,200 lbs.

These specs make the GMC Sierra not only suitable for tough jobs but also for adventurous trips where reliability and power are key.

GMC Sierra Interior 

Step inside the GMC Sierra interior, and you immediately notice the attention to detail. It blends comfort and functionality effortlessly. Highlights include:

  • Premium materials: Soft-touch surfaces, leather upholstery in higher trims.

  • Advanced infotainment: 8-13 inch touchscreen display with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, and wireless charging.

  • Spacious cabin: Ample legroom and headroom for front and rear passengers.

  • Storage solutions: Multiple compartments, under-seat storage, and flexible cargo management.

  • Luxury trim (Denali): Heated and ventilated seats, Bose premium audio, and wood or aluminum accents.

The interior isn’t just about aesthetics; it’s about driver comfort, passenger satisfaction, and functional design for everyday use and long trips.

 GMC Sierra Mileage 

Truck owners often worry about fuel economy, especially for large vehicles. The GMC Sierra mileage varies by engine type:

  • 4.3L V6: Approximately 17 MPG city / 23 MPG highway.

  • 5.3L V8: Around 16 MPG city / 22 MPG highway.

  • 6.2L V8: Approximately 15 MPG city / 21 MPG highway.

  • 3.0L Turbo-Diesel I6: Up to 23 MPG city / 30 MPG highway.

The diesel variant is especially popular among those who require both power and efficiency for long hauls, offering a balanced combination of torque, fuel savings, and towing capability.

 GMC Sierra vs Ford F-150 

Truck enthusiasts often compare the GMC Sierra vs Ford F-150, two giants in the pickup segment. Here’s a quick comparison:

Feature GMC Sierra 2025 Ford F-150
Base Price $43,000 $41,000
Engine Options V6, V8, Diesel V6, V8, Hybrid
Interior Quality Luxurious, premium Functional, slightly rugged
Towing Capacity Up to 13,200 lbs Up to 14,000 lbs
Tech & Safety Advanced infotainment, GMC Pro Safety Ford Co-Pilot360
Luxury Trim Denali Limited/Platinum
